Introduction Flexible printed circuit boards (FPC) and Rigid-Flex printed circuit boards demonstrate advanced circuit board technology that twists, bends and folds to fit unique product designs. You find these bendable circuit boards everywhere in modern electronics, smartphones, wearables, medical devices, and automotive systems. The common material for flexible PCB manufacturing

Flexible PCBs (Printed Circuit Boards) use kinds of materials for their substrates, conductive layers, adhesive, and coverlay.
